What does an entry level corporate financial analyst do?

A corporate financial analyst examines market trends and the financial aspects of a company or industry and forecasts the outcome of business or investment strategies. As an entry-level financial analyst, you research economic trends and evaluate the growth and profitability of a company under the supervision of an experienced analyst. You collect and provide analysis of relevant data points, such as comparing the operating budget to company profit, and consider the outcome of similar transactions. The primary goal of your position is to develop strategies to leverage assets and increase profits. Your job duties also require you to report your findings and opinions to executive leadership and help them explore the potential impact of business decisions.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an entry level corporate financial analyst,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Entry Level Corporate Financial Analyst, you need a solid background in finance, accounting, and data analysis, typically supported by a bachelor’s degree in finance or a related field. Familiarity with financial modeling, Microsoft Excel, and enterprise resource planning (ERP) systems like SAP or Oracle is often required. Strong attention to detail, analytical thinking, and effective communication help you interpret data and present findings clearly to stakeholders. These skills and qualities are crucial for providing accurate financial insights that guide business decisions and support organizational growth.

What are some common challenges faced by entry level corporate financial analysts, and how can new hires effectively overcome them?

Entry-level corporate financial analysts often encounter challenges such as adapting to complex financial modeling, learning to interpret large volumes of data, and understanding the company's specific financial processes. New hires may also find it demanding to communicate their analyses clearly to non-financial colleagues or stakeholders. To overcome these challenges, it is helpful to seek mentorship from experienced team members, utilize online training resources for technical skills, and actively participate in team meetings to better understand the business context and decision-making process.

What is the difference between Entry Level Corporate Financial Analyst vs Financial Associate?

AspectEntry Level Corporate Financial AnalystFinancial Associate
Required CredentialsBachelor's degree in finance, accounting, or related field; internships often preferredBachelor's degree in finance, accounting, or related field; some roles may require certifications like CFA Level I
Work EnvironmentCorporate finance departments, investment firms, or consulting firmsFinancial services firms, banks, or investment companies
Employer & Industry UsageCommonly used in corporate finance teams across industriesUsed in banking, asset management, and financial services sectors

Both roles typically require a bachelor's degree in finance or related fields. Entry Level Corporate Financial Analysts focus on financial planning, analysis, and reporting within corporations, while Financial Associates often work in banking or investment firms, handling client accounts and financial transactions. The roles share similar credentials but differ in work environment and specific responsibilities.

Job description

POSITION SUMMARY
We are seeking a Corporate FP&A Intern for our Summer 2027 Internship Program. This internship offers a dynamic opportunity to gain hands-on experience in financial planning, analysis, and business support across our Corporate team. This role will provide exposure to strategic financial processes, cross-functional collaboration, and real-world business insights.
U.S. Venture's Internship Program runs May - August. Dates may vary based on individual class schedules. This position is located at our Corporate Office in Appleton, WI.
JOB R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Support the Corporate FP&A team in developing operational and financial analyses to inform decision-making

  • Assist in the annual budgeting process, including data collection, review, and presentation preparation

  • Contribute to month-end close activities for U.S. Lubricants and Corporate Resource Groups, including reporting and variance analysis

  • Participate in project work focused on financial modeling, process improvement, and reporting automation

  • Learn and assist with enterprise analytics, including valuation modeling and performance metrics

  • Provide ad hoc financial reporting and analysis support as needed across the Corporate team

QUALIFICATIONS
  • Current student pursuing a bachelor's degree in Finance, Accounting, or a related field
  • Junior or Senior status preferred
  • Strong proficiency in Microsoft Excel and Word; familiarity with financial systems or data visualization tools is a plus
  •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ills
  • Strong communication and customer service orientation
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a fast-paced environment
  • Interest in learning about both corporate finance and business unit operations
